MEMO — Project Lanthorn Delay. Branch managers, the Lanthorn systems consolidation is now expected to complete in the second quarter of next year, roughly five months behind schedule. The delay stems from integration issues with the Pellworth inventory module and contractor turnover at the Marbeck site. Existing branch systems remain supported throughout; no local action is required beyond the usual data hygiene checks. Revised milestones will circulate next week. The confidential note below explains how this delay affects our wider plans.

board note of kagep-yahig: Only 9 of the 120 pilot accounts renewed Quenix, so a churn review is set for April 1.

# Basement Archive Room — Night Access

The archive room under Pellworth House holds old contracts and the tape backups. Night shift: take stairwell C, not the lift (it's switched off after midnight). Lights are on a timer by the door — slap the button as you go in. Sign the logbook, even at 3am, yes really. The keypad by the door takes the code below.

staff pass of fahap-tajeg = bdg-FT-6

For branch managers. Status: the Marwick Provisions franchise agreement is up for renewal in Q2. Terms under negotiation: royalty rate, territory exclusivity for the Ashgrove corridor, and shared marketing contributions. Marwick has performed above benchmark for three consecutive years. Leadership intends to renew with revised territory language. Branches should not discuss terms externally until signing. Managers will receive talking points after the review. The position leadership is taking into negotiations follows below.

board note of kageg-bahof: The renewal with Holwynax Holdings closes at $2 million a year, 5 percent below the last contract. Project Ulaath slips by two quarters because of the supplier delay.